Le Buffet de l’Antiquaire, c’est la cuisine québécoise à son meilleur, pure tradition depuis plus de 40 ans! Jour après jour, notre personnel se fait un point d’honneur de vous accueillir chaleureusement dans ce restaurant aux mille histoires. Lève-tôt? Nos copieux déjeuners vous sont servis toute la journée, et ce, dès 6 h. Vous ne saurez résister à notre confiture maison pour laquelle certains font bien des kilomètres. Au dîner, ce sont plus de 16 plats qui rivalisent afin de combler votre estomac et séduire vos papilles. En été, nul doute que notre terrasse est l’endroit tout indiqué pour vivre l’effervescence du Vieux-Port. Amant de l’hiver, laissez-vous charmer par les rues enneigées et scintillantes juste avant d’être conforté entre nos murs de pierres. Savourez le bonheur de plats authentiques et généreux tels le ragoût de boulettes et de pattes, le pâté à la viande de grand-mère ou encore notre prisé cipaille. Le Buffet de l’Antiquaire, un plaisir à petit prix dans le plus beau quartier de Québec.
Buffet de L'Antiquaire est largement reconnu comme une destination incontournable pour savourer une cuisine réconfortante et authentique du Québec, offrant de généreuses portions et une ambiance chaleureuse de style restaurant classique qui plaît autant aux résidents qu'aux visiteurs. La clientèle souligne régulièrement la qualité de ses déjeuners, notamment pour des plats comme les œufs bénédictine, la poutine et les tourtières traditionnelles, souvent accompagnés de confiture aux fraises maison. Bien que l'endroit soit très populaire et puisse entraîner une attente, beaucoup trouvent que la qualité des plats, le service attentionné et les prix abordables en font une expérience mémorable, poussant plusieurs clients à y revenir à maintes reprises lors de leur séjour.
